On Fri, Jul 25, 2003 at 01:04:02PM -0400, Jason Parsons wrote: > > Does the -u flag require a "real" username, or can it be set > arbitrarily to an email address? Care to share your qmail-scanner > patch?
I am using virtual users with info stored in MySQL so it uses the email address (multiple addresses can be mapped to a single set of preferences). It's not my patch actually. The patch is on the qmail-scanner page on sourceforge - http://sourceforge.net/tracker/?group_id=6116&atid=306116 642206 vpopmail and spamassassin user prefs v2 * 2002-11-22 01:49 it is for 1.15, but i have gotten it to work with 1.16 (it adds a couple things to 1.15 that were added to 1.16 so it complains the lines already exist). -- Random Tagline: Politicians are the same all over.
